In addition to NATO HQ, the following NATO Agencies and Bodies offer internships via NATO HQ (please submit your application as stipulated in the Application section):

  • NAMSA

    The NATO Maintenance and Supply Agency (NAMSA) is NATO’s principal logistics support management agency. NAMSA’s main task is to assist NATO nations by organizing common procurement and supply of spare parts and arranging maintenance and repair services necessary for the support of various weapon systems in their inventories. The Agency’s main role is in consolidating nations’ requirements, centralizing logistics management activities, conducting international competitive bidding processes and controlling the cost and quality of the services rendered to customers. In recent years, the Agency has become increasingly involved in providing logistical support for NATO operations, and in leading demilitarisation projects. http://www.namsa.nato.int

  • RTA

    The NATO Research and Technology Agency is the executive agency of the NATO Research and Technology Organisation. It facilitates collaboration between 26 NATO allies and 38 partners on scietific research and technical information by organising a wide range of studies, workshops and other forums in which researchers can meet and exchange knowledge. http://www.rta.nato.int

The following bodies and agencies have their own internship programmes and take applications directly:

  • NC3A

    With roots going back over 50 years, the mission of the NATO C3 Agency is to support NATO through the seamless provision of unbiased scientific support and common funded acquisition of Consultation, Command, Control, Communications,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ance (C4ISR) capabilities. http://www.nc3a.nato.int/vacancies/index.html

  • SACT

    NATO’s Allied Command Transformation leads the Alliance’s continuous improvement of its capabilities to uphold its security interests. ACT’s priorities are primarily to transform NATO’s military capabilities, to prepare, support and sustain Alliance operations, as well as to implement NATO Response Force capabilities and assist transformation of partner capabilities. http://www.act.nato.int/content.asp?pageid=1220

  • SHAPE

    Supreme Headquarters Allied Powers Europe (SHAPE) near Mons, Belgium is the Headquarters of Allied Command Operations (ACO), one of NATO's two strategic military commands. ACO is commanded by the Supreme Allied Commander Europe (SACEUR) and responsible for all Alliance operations, ranging from the Straits of Gibraltar to Afghanistan. http://www.nato.int/shape/community/internship/index.ht
